Follow the steps exactly as detailed in this guide.
If the n3DSXL does not wake or show any sign of life from the above, try rubbing a magnet around the ABXY buttons area and backside in case this is a stuck sleep switch.

Lastly, if you have an ntrboot compatible DS flashcart, get another (o/n)(2/3)DS(i)(XL/LL)(phat/lite) with working DS(i) mode to reflash it into ntrboot mode. Try to revive the n3DSXL by rehacking it with that ntrboot cart. If you don't see the SafeB9SInstaller screen, that likely means the n3DSXL sepppuked itself.

@andrevc6, if those above ideas do nothing,
  • (1) reformat + h2testw the microSD card, and add boot.firm (SafeB9SInstaller v0.0.7) / arm9loaderhax.bin (Luma3DS v7.0.5).
  • (2) magnet sweep the ABXY areas.
  • (3) ntrboot rehack
, disassemble the n3DSXL and take a multimeter to test the F1 + F2 microfuses for continuity.

If you have another n3DSXL or have a friend who is willing to let you borrow theirs to take apart, the easiest way to determine if it's the motherboard or powerboard that's bad is to swap the motherboards between the two n3DSXL systems.

Other than that, there's no real way of knowing except to gamble buying a replacement powerboard (currently around US $30 on aliexpress, yikes!) and hoping that changing it out is what cures the no boot issue. Or, find someone locally that specializes in repairing video game systems or Nintendo handhelds including the 2DS/3DS family.
